Tips for choosing an automotive diagnostic tool for Mercedes SL500 (2005 model)
 
When dealing with automotive diagnostics for the Mercedes SL500 (2005 model), choosing the right diagnostic tool can make all the difference in maintenance and troubleshooting your vehicle. Here are some tips to help you choose the best option, as well as an overview of the most used tools among enthusiasts and professionals.

1. Determine Your Needs
First, decide what you want from a car diagnostic tool.
- Basic Diagnostics: Tools to read and clear trouble codes, view live data, and reset service indicators.
- Advanced Features: Tools for programming, coding, and detailed diagnostics of systems such as suspension, transmission, and airbags.
- Mercedes-specific Features: If you want all-around protection for your SL500, look for a tool that's specific for Mercedes cars.



2. Popular Diagnostic Tools for Mercedes SL500
A. iCarsoft MB V3.0
- Key Features: Read and clear codes for all systems, support oil reset, provide live data.
- Why it's popular: Affordable and easy to use, perfect for beginners.
- Limitations: No programming or coding capabilities.

B. Autel MaxiCOM MK808
- Key Features: Full system diagnostics, service reset, large touchscreen interface.
- Why it's popular: Rich features for multiple brands, not just Mercedes, at a reasonable price.
- Limitations: Limited Mercedes specific programming.

C. Mercedes Star Diagnostic (Xentry/DAS)
- Main features: Diagnostics, coding and programming at OEM level.
- Why it's popular: The most comprehensive option for Mercedes cars, capable of handling any diagnostic or programming task.
- Limitations: More expensive, requires laptop and compatible hardware (e.g. C4 or C6 multiplexer).



3. Tool Selection Considerations
- Compatibility: Make sure the tool supports the W230 chassis and systems like ABC suspension, engine management, and transmission.
- Ease of Use: Beginners may prefer tools with intuitive interfaces and guided workflows.
- Budget: Prices range from $100 for basic tools to over $1,000 for professional equipment.
- Future Needs: Investing in more advanced tools now can save you money later when planning bigger jobs.



4. Tips for using diagnostic tools
- Learn the basics: Become familiar with diagnostic terminology and your car's systems.
- Research trouble codes: If a trouble code appears, consult online forums or a Mercedes repair manual for troubleshooting advice.
- Start simple: Start with basic tasks like reading and clearing codes and gradually explore more advanced features.



Following these tips will help you choose the diagnostic tool that best suits your needs and knowledge. For the Mercedes SL500, the Mercedes Star Diagnostic System is the best, while options like iCarsoft and Autel MaxiCOM are great for less demanding tasks.
